I usually double rig with a 1/16th blue/white hair jig on the bottom and a 1/64th (and sometimes a 1/80th) orange head/peacock herl body/ pheasant tail above it. The peacock herl jig has been my most consistent winter jig over the last 20-25 years. Lately though, a pink estaz/ green chartreuse marabou jig has killed them.
